Engine Maintenance

Servicing the Air Cleaner

Service Interval: Before each use or daily—Check the
air-filter-service indicator.
Every 25 hours—Remove air-cleaner cover, clean out
debris, and check the air-filter-service indicator.
Servicing the Air-Cleaner Cover and
Body
Important: Service the air-cleaner filter only when the
service indicator shows red
air filter before it is necessary only increases the chance
of dirt entering the engine when you remove the filter.
1. Lower the loader arms, shut off the engine, and remove
the key.
2. Open the hood.
3. Check the air-cleaner body for damage which could
cause an air leak.. Check the whole intake system for
leaks, damage, or loose hose clamps. Replace of repair
and damaged components.
4. Release the latches on the air cleaner and pull the
air-cleaner cover off the air-cleaner body
Important: Do not remove the air filters.

5. Squeeze the dust cap sides to open it and knock the
dust out.
6. Clean the inside of the air-cleaner cover with
compressed air.

7. Check the air-filter-service indicator.
If the service indicator is clear, clean any debris
from cover and install cover.
Ensure that the cover is seated correctly and seals
with the air-cleaner body.
If the service indicator is red, replace the air filter
as described in
Replacing the Filters
1. Gently slide the primary filter out of the air-cleaner
body
(Figure
33). Avoid knocking the filter into the
side of the body.
Important: Do not attempt to clean the primary
filter.
2. Inspect the new filter(s) for damage by looking into the
filter while shining a bright light on the outside of the
filter. Holes in the filter appear as bright spots. Inspect
the element for tears, an oily film, or damage to the
rubber seal. If the filter is damaged, do not use it.
3. Carefully slide the primary filter into the filter body
(Figure
33). Ensure that it is fully seated by pushing on
the outer rim of the filter while installing it.
Important: Do not press on the soft inside area
of the filter.
4. Install the air-cleaner cover with the side indicated as
UP facing up and secure the latches
5. Close the hood.

Servicing the Carbon Canister

Replacing the Carbon-Canister Air
Filter
Service Interval: Every 200 hours—Replace the
carbon-canister air filter (Service
more frequently if conditions are
extremely dusty or sandy).
1. Lower the loader arms, shut off the engine, and remove
the key.
2. Remove the rear-access cover; see
Rear-Access Cover (page
3. Remove and discard the air filter
